Situated in Evergreen, CO, The Barn at Evergreen Memorial Park is a countryside wedding venue set amidst a 100-acre private ranch estate. Originally owned by the Lewis family, who purchased the estate in 1965, this mountain view venue provides a peaceful and panoramic backdrop for special celebrations. This idyllic animal ranch is home to elk, buffalo, deer, foxes, and owls, which adds to the property's authentic rural charm.
From the American-style barn to the scenic gardens and pond, The Barn at Evergreen has plenty to offer prospective newlyweds. The state-of-the-art chapel was constructed from the recycled wood of five old barns. The most striking aspect of this arched barn is the stunning stained glass that adorns the windows. Rustic refinement abounds in this historic chapel, as high ceiling beams and wooden interiors are married with ambient string lighting and elegant furnishings. You can say ‘I do’ outdoors at The Fields or host a traditional ceremony in the chapel. The Barn is transformed for evening receptions, with floorplans curated to reflect your vision, whether you desire a formal seated meal or relaxed buffet service. The polished wooden flooring lends itself to dancing and entertainment.
The experienced staff at The Barn at Evergreen Memorial Park wants to make your dream day a reality. They customize their services according to your wishes and offer advice when it comes to selecting vendors. Their list of trusted suppliers includes bartending companies, food trucks, transport, hair and makeup, photographers, and more. You are free to select the caterer of your choice and the barn can be decorated to reflect your theme, whether that is classic elegance or vintage boho-chic.
Pricing details
Starting prices
Reception
$4,000
Reception
$4,000
Ceremony
Contact for price
Bar services
Contact for price
Catering
Contact for price
- Couples usually spend $6,500
- Starting prices don't include service fees, taxes, gratuity, and rental fees.
- Guest count and seasonality may also affect prices. Peak season for this venue is May-Oct.
